80a1469 – 5408   Catoptria latiradiellus (Walker, 1863)
             Three-spotted Crambid

Synonymy:
  • latiradiellus (Walker, 1863) (Crambus) - MONA 1983: 5408
  • interruptus (Grote, 1877) (Crambus)
  • luctuellus of authors; (not Herrich-Schäffer, [1855]) (Crambus) misappl.
  • myellus of authors; (not Hübner, 1796) (Crambus) misappl.
